#1638d3 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#1638d3 is composed of 8.6% red, 22% green and 82.7%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 89.6% cyan, 73.5% magenta, 0% yellow and 17.3% black. It has a hue angle of 229.2 degrees, a saturation of 81.1% and a lightness of 45.7%. #1638d3 color hex could be obtained by blending #2c70ff with #0000a7. Closest websafe color is: #0033cc.

Shades and Tints of #1638d3

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#020410 is the darkest color, while #fdfdff is the lightest one.

Tones of #1638d3

A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#707179 is the less saturated color, while #042de5 is the most saturated one.
